Output d8fbc21d9652aaf1ba4f39722f05e3a6f5c11c2a68aac1cd055e84ba8f01b9b5:2

value
363513
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 649f018f63b662d21379d88adaaebdcf8fd1514087c50067bf348e6bee3588aa
address
tb1pvj0srrmrke3dyymemz9d4t4ae78az52qslzsqealxj8xhm343z4qmqfqh6
transaction
d8fbc21d9652aaf1ba4f39722f05e3a6f5c11c2a68aac1cd055e84ba8f01b9b5
confirmations
20875
spent
true